>> I have an HTML Form Post front-end creating an event that I would like to
>> pass through the NMR to various endpoints. I am getting an error:
>>
>> javax.jbi.messaging.protocol.headers: null
>> [Fatal Error] :1:1: Content is not allowed in prolog.
>>
>> I am pretty sure that this is because it is taking my "Content-Type:
>> application/x-www-form-urlencoded" and trying to whip it across the NMR
>> without any transformation to XML first.
>>
>> How do I fix this? (And) If this is not the problem, any ideas what is?
>
> The error is because the default marshaler doesn't know how to handle
> the content. But adding the ability to handle this case shouldn't be
> very difficult at all.
>
> I'm assuming that you've deployed a servicemix-http service unit
> configured to fulfill the consumer role. If this is the case, then the
> problem is that the DefaultHttpConsumerMarshaler will not handle that
> content type. Marshalers are used to transform message content to/from
> XML so that it can be stuffed into/extracted from a NormalizedMessage.
>
> To handle this case, a marshaler will need to be added to the
> servicemix-http component in the org.apache.servicemix.http.endpoints
> package so that it can be configured in the servicemix-http service
> unit configuration. See the DefaultHttpConsumerMarshaler and the
> SerializedMarshaler for examples.
